    Fabulous recipe. My husband and I both loved it! I couldn't find hazelnuts so I used almonds instead. Since I was substituting the nuts, I also changed the liquor to Amaretto (Frangelico is a hazelnut flavored liquor; Amaretto is an almond flavored liquor. The flavors were perfect; not too much alcohol and not too much lemon. Thanks Giada!
